WebV W X Y Z N+2A Also known as: N+A N+2A is a measure of how well a heavy naphtha will perform when fed to a reformer, that is how high the octane of the resulting reformate will be. N+2A is calculated as the volume percent of naphthenes in the naphtha plus 2 times the volume of aromatics. Reforming is the total effect of several … thingiverse hrabisWebReforming is a process designed to increase the volume of gasoline that can be produced from a barrel of crude oil. Hydrocarbons in the naphtha stream have roughly the same number of carbon atoms as those in gasoline, but their structure is generally more complex. Reforming rearranges naphtha hydrocarbons into gasoline molecules. thingiverse huggy wuggyCatalytic reforming is a chemical process used to convert petroleum refinery naphthas distilled from crude oil (typically having low octane ratings) into high-octane liquid products called reformates, which are premium blending stocks for high-octane gasoline.
